Episode description

How do changes in the perceptual information available alter movement variability? If we constrain vision with occluding glasses or constrain audition with headphones how do performers adapt their movements? How does this depend on skill level?

 

Article:

The role of variability in the control of the basketball dribble under different perceptual setups
